The whole migration code works on the usable_length of ram blocks and does not expect this to change at random points in time. Precopy: The ram block size must not change on the source, after ram_save_setup(), so as long as the guest is still running on the source. Postcopy: The ram block size must not change on the target, after synchronizing the RAM block list (ram_load_precopy()). AFAIKS, resizing can be trigger *after* (but not during) a reset in ACPI code by the guest - hw/arm/virt-acpi-build.c:acpi_ram_update() - hw/i386/acpi-build.c:acpi_ram_update() I see no easy way to work around this. Fail hard instead of failing somewhere in migration code due to strange other reasons. AFAIKs, the rebuilts will be triggered during reboot, so this should not affect running guests, but only guests that reboot at a very bad time and actually require size changes. Let's further limit the impact by checking if an actual resize of the RAM (in number of pages) is required. Don't perform the checks in qemu_ram_resize(), as that's called during migration when syncing the used_length. Update documentation.
